Hi again...

You all were so helpful before I figure I will ask another question... Much easier this time :rotfl:

If I am taking I-77 to I-95 down, how close do we get to the ocean? We have never been to the ocean and I was wondering how far out of the way it is to make a quick stop to take a look and maybe put our toes in...

I see that we drive pretty close to the coast but I thought maybe someone would know exactly how close...

Thanks for any info... I hope this will be my last question but I can't promise! :confused3


Christina :wave2:
 
When we hit the Daytona area you are only 15 minutes or so I believe. It wasn't far.
 
When you are in Orlando you are just 1 hour and 30 minutes from Atlantic Ocean and 1 hour and 45 minutes from the Gulf coast. We have visited both sides and loved our visit.
We plan our trip to Port Canaveral on a Sunday so we can see the Disney ship set sail, have a late lunch at FishLips which is right by the port where the Disney ship is. You can go out on their balcony and watch the boat pass by. Or go to Jetty park and watch the boat set sail from there & watch the turtles and mantee swim by.
When we go to the gulf coast we always visit HoneyMoon Island. It is a Florida state park and its right on the coast. It has tons and tons of shells, a nice bath house for changing into swim wear - it is very very clean. They have a cafe to grab lunch at. You can rent beach equipement also. Cost is $8 a car to get into the park. We prefer to go here on a hot day because its usually 10 degrees cooler on the coast than in Orlando.

We got off 95 near Flagler Beach and had lunch. It was a very quick & easy detour before heading into the Orlando area. Definitely worth the detour.
 

From Savannah (Tybee Island) to Daytona Beach, you are no more than 15 minutes from dipping your toes into the ocean. :goodvibes Anywhere along I-95, you can pull off the highway and travel east to see the waves. We drive from Ohio and on one trip, we drove all the way to Daytona and stayed for the night. We spent the morning on the beach and headed to Disney after lunch to arrive just in time for check-in. It is definitely an option. :thumbsup2
